The Problem of the Uneaten Sin Offering
16 Then[a] Moses sought all over for the goat of the sin offering and behold, it was burned up. So[b] he was angry with Aaron’s remaining sons Eleazar and Ithamar, saying, 17 “Why did you not eat the sin offering on the sanctuary’s site, because it is a most holy thing?[c] And he gave it to you to remove the community’s guilt, to make atonement for them before[d] Yahweh. 18 Look, its blood was not brought inside the sanctuary.[e] Certainly you should have eaten it in the sanctuary, as I commanded.”
19 So[f] Aaron said to Moses, “Look, today they presented their sin offering and their burnt offering before[g] Yahweh, and things such as these have happened to me, and if I were to eat a sin offering today, would it have been good in Yahweh’s eyes?” 20 When[h] Moses heard, it[i] was good in his eyes.

Leviticus 10:16-20
New International Version
16 When Moses inquired about the goat of the sin offering[a](A) and found that it had been burned up, he was angry with Eleazar and Ithamar, Aaron’s remaining sons, and asked, 17 “Why didn’t you eat the sin offering(B) in the sanctuary area? It is most holy; it was given to you to take away the guilt(C) of the community by making atonement for them before the Lord. 18 Since its blood was not taken into the Holy Place,(D) you should have eaten the goat in the sanctuary area, as I commanded.(E)”
19 Aaron replied to Moses, “Today they sacrificed their sin offering and their burnt offering(F) before the Lord, but such things as this have happened to me. Would the Lord have been pleased if I had eaten the sin offering today?” 20 When Moses heard this, he was satisfied.
